请问各位大神关于labview和arduino控制步进电机的问题

2019-07-17 12:48发布

希望可以用labview做人机界面,通过长按按钮控制电机连续转动,不知道如何设置按钮可以使其一直保持按下并可以发送字符串(arduino接收字符串后会按照接收的字符串控制驱动板)。现在点动控制和自动控制部分都已实现,现在就希望可以不用不断的点那个按钮而是可以像键盘一样一直按着走。。。望各位大侠指点。谢谢了。
友情提示: 此问题已得到解决,问题已经关闭,关闭后问题禁止继续编辑,回答。
该问题目前已经被作者或者管理员关闭, 无法添加新回复
18条回答
dlutccj
1楼-- · 2019-07-17 14:23
 精彩回答 2  元偷偷看……
15951867373
2楼-- · 2019-07-17 15:04
在超时里面判断键的值
njustzr
3楼-- · 2019-07-17 19:08
dlutccj 发表于 2015-4-13 21:12
labview有arduino工具包不需要发命令,直接拿arduino当控制卡用就可以

您好,之前我也有装过LIFA的包,可以用它通过arduino控制多个步进电机,但是我还要再集成别的功能,还需要通过控制arduino来启动和关闭焊接电源,所以才转而使用VISA函数来进行串口通信,觉着这样会比较灵活一些,以后还要增加什么功能应该也更方便。同样非常感谢您的建议。
njustzr
4楼-- · 2019-07-18 00:19
15951867373 发表于 2015-4-13 21:41
在超时里面判断键的值

您好,不太理解您的想法,不知道可否说的更加详细一点,我是想 一. 通过循环当键按下时不停发送某个字符这样单片机可以不断接收从而控制电机不停转动。二. 判断按键时间长短将时间转换为字符串传给单片机作为电机转动的时间。如有不妥,还望多指教, 谢谢了。
15951867373
5楼-- · 2019-07-18 01:00
你应该是用的一个事件结构外面套一个循环,然后超时事件设置为你想要发送指令的间隔,在超时里面判断按键是否按下,按下就发送转的指令
nianlan031
6楼-- · 2019-07-18 05:03
 精彩回答 2  元偷偷看……

一周热门 更多>